Discarded Cigarette?

Photo: Diane Edwardson, September 30, 2009, 10:43 AM. Two LAFD ladder trucks and a small fire engine responded to a grass fire on the 2 Freeway below my home. (Click on photo to enlarge.)

Seeing a large cloud of smoke out my rear window and hearing sirens, I immediately thought it was a fire at one of the Semi Tropic Spiritualists' Tract homeless encampments. Luckily, the LAFD made quick work of a grass fire on the 2 Freeway. Usually, there's a vehicle on fire that spread to the brush. No such vehicle was nearby. Nor is this a homeless encampment.

CalTrans did some brush clearance in the medians a few weeks ago, but stopped at this section. You can see the taller grass on either side of the burned area. DO NOT TOSS YOUR CIGARETTES OUT THE WINDOW OF YOUR CAR!
